Issac Branco

Isaac’s work is an attempt to understand how people look at their surroundings both in the real world and the cyber one as the constant intersection of both creates an interesting playground for art practices. The work here shown is part of the research done as a way of not only comment on the subject but interact directly with it. Taking a symbol widely recognised in the social medias context and placing it on things and places that would normally be marked with it once their pictures reached those platforms, the goal here is to question the difference in reactions from the digital world to the physical one. Are those reactions the same? Or is the work met with suspicion due to its obvious critical objective?
